The role of glycans, the sugars that cover our cells, in Alzheimer's disease is being studied. Glycans may have the ability to regulate the aggregation and toxicity of amyloid-beta, the protein responsible for forming plaques in the brains of Alzheimer's patients. A new study has discovered that glycans, a type of sugar molecule, play a key role in the development of Alzheimer’s disease. Glycans are found on the surface of cells and can affect their interactions and functions. The study found that glycans can modulate the aggregation and toxicity of amyloid-beta, a protein that forms plaques in the brains of Alzheimer’s patients.
